Blockchain For Secure Real Estate Transactions

The integration of blockchain technology into the real estate sector is poised to revolutionize the way transactions are conducted, offering unprecedented levels of security and efficiency. As the real estate industry continues to evolve, the adoption of marketing technology, or martech, is becoming increasingly essential. This shift is not merely a trend but a necessary adaptation to the demands of a digital-first world. Blockchain, a decentralized ledger technology, is at the forefront of this transformation, providing a secure and transparent platform for real estate transactions.

One of the most significant advantages of blockchain in real estate is its ability to enhance security. Traditional real estate transactions often involve multiple intermediaries, such as brokers, banks, and legal advisors, each adding layers of complexity and potential vulnerability. Blockchain technology, however, allows for the creation of smart contracts, which are self-executing contracts with the terms of the agreement directly written into code. These smart contracts eliminate the need for intermediaries, reducing the risk of fraud and ensuring that all parties adhere to the agreed-upon terms.

Moreover, blockchain’s immutable nature ensures that once a transaction is recorded, it cannot be altered or tampered with. This feature is particularly beneficial in real estate, where the integrity of property records is paramount. By maintaining a transparent and tamper-proof record of ownership, blockchain can significantly reduce the incidence of title fraud, a persistent issue in the industry. This increased security not only protects buyers and sellers but also instills greater confidence in the market as a whole.

In addition to enhancing security, blockchain technology streamlines the transaction process, making it more efficient and cost-effective. Traditional real estate transactions can be time-consuming and costly, often taking weeks or even months to complete. The involvement of multiple parties and the need for extensive paperwork contribute to these delays. Blockchain, however, simplifies this process by enabling peer-to-peer transactions, which can be completed in a matter of hours. This efficiency is further enhanced by the elimination of intermediaries, resulting in lower transaction costs.

Furthermore, blockchain technology facilitates greater transparency in real estate transactions. All parties involved in a transaction have access to the same information, reducing the likelihood of disputes and misunderstandings. This transparency extends to the broader market as well, as blockchain can provide real-time data on property values, transaction history, and market trends. Such insights are invaluable for investors, developers, and policymakers, enabling them to make informed decisions based on accurate and up-to-date information.

Automation In Lead Generation And Management

In the rapidly evolving landscape of real estate, the integration of marketing technology, or martech, is revolutionizing how professionals generate and manage leads. As the industry becomes increasingly competitive, the adoption of automation tools is not just a trend but a necessity for staying ahead. Automation in lead generation and management is transforming traditional practices, offering unprecedented efficiency and precision.

To begin with, automation streamlines the lead generation process by leveraging data analytics and artificial intelligence. These technologies enable real estate professionals to identify potential clients with greater accuracy. By analyzing vast amounts of data, such as online behavior, search patterns, and demographic information, automated systems can pinpoint individuals who are most likely to be interested in buying or selling property. This targeted approach not only saves time but also increases the likelihood of converting leads into clients.

Moreover, automation enhances the management of leads by ensuring timely and personalized communication. Once potential clients are identified, automated systems can send tailored messages that resonate with their specific needs and preferences. For instance, if a prospective buyer has shown interest in a particular neighborhood, the system can automatically send them listings and updates related to that area. This level of personalization fosters a stronger connection between the client and the real estate professional, thereby increasing the chances of a successful transaction.

In addition to improving communication, automation tools facilitate efficient lead nurturing. Through automated workflows, real estate agents can maintain consistent engagement with leads over time. These workflows can include a series of emails, text messages, or even social media interactions that keep the client informed and engaged. By automating these processes, agents can focus on building relationships rather than getting bogged down by repetitive tasks. This not only enhances productivity but also ensures that no lead falls through the cracks.

Furthermore, automation in lead management provides valuable insights through advanced analytics. By tracking interactions and responses, real estate professionals can gain a deeper understanding of what strategies are working and what needs improvement. This data-driven approach allows for continuous optimization of marketing efforts, ensuring that resources are allocated effectively. As a result, agents can make informed decisions that drive better outcomes for their business.
